Q: Is 3,622,510 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,622,510 is a composite number.

Why is 3,622,510 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,622,510 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 103 206 515 1,030 3,517 7,034 17,585 35,170 362,251 724,502 1,811,255 and 3,622,510, with no remainder.

Since 3,622,510 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,622,510, it is a composite number.
